Anatomy of the abdominal cavity showing the coeliac trunk a major artery arising from the abdominal aorta. The coeliac trunk gives branches to a wide variety of organs and tissues such as the liver,gall bladder,spleen,stomach and duodenum. Other smaller branches supply the greater omentum shown here covering the underlying intestines. From Sobotta,J. (1906) Atlas der deskriptiven Anatomie des Menschen. Vol 3,Das Nerven- und Gefasssystem des Menschen. J. F. Lehmann,Munchen,Fig 514. | |
